Part I. Understanding the formats compatible with iPad
You know that 9.7-inch high-resolution screen makes iPad perfect for watching video, but that doesn't mean that every type of video file will play on your iPad. The iPad supported video formats are:
H.264 video (up to 720p, 30 frames per second; main profile level 3.1 with AAC-LC audio up to 160 Kbps, 48kHz, stereo audio in .m4v, .mp4, and .mov file formats);
MPEG-4 video (up to 2.5 Mbps, 640 by 480 pixels, 30 frames per second, simple profile with AAC-LC audio up to 160 Kbps, 48kHz, stereo audio in .m4v, .mp4, and .mov file formats).

Part II. Converting DVDs
One of the most common sources of iPad content will be DVDs. Although the legality of ripping the content from DVDs varies in different jurisdictions, many countries outside of the U.S. have no specific restrictions on the conversion of DVDs that you already own into other viewable formats.

On the Mac platform, the most commonly used tools for DVD extraction is MacTheRipper.

MacTheRipper is a simple DVD ripping tool; it does not actually convert video, but merely extracts it from the DVD. The use of MacTheRipper is relatively straightforward: Simply insert a DVD and start the application and you will be presented with a main screen of MacTheRipper.


MacTheRipper defaults to full disc extraction, it will simply extract ALL content from the DVD. To extract a title from the DVD as a specific file, you instead need to click the “Mode” tab and choose “Title - Chapter Extraction” from the pull-down menu. The result of this operation will be in MPEG-2 format, and can be viewed through any software application capable of MPEG-2 playback, or converted using one of the tools discussed further in Part III.

Part III. Converting Standard Digital Video and HD Video Content
Standard Digital Video Content refers to the various types of digital content that can be stored on a computer, such as that obtained from web sites and already pre-extracted from DVDs into other non-iPad-ready formats. HD Video Content means high definition video. The HD video generally refers to any video system of higher resolution than standard-definition video, most of them are at display resolutions of 1280×720 (720p) or 1920×1080 (1080i or 1080p), and obtained from AVCHD and other HD digital camcorder.

There are many free tools for iPad video conversion on Mac, like iSquint, VisualHub, MPEG Streamclip, etc. But iSquint and VisualHub have been discontinued and are no longer for sale, while MPEG Streamclip cannot convert HD video content. Maybe you can convert HD video from most digital camcorders through Apple's iMovie HD application included in iLife '06 or above. But iMovie does not provide any additional default presets for higher-resolution iPad, also the conversion times will be quite slow as it uses the underlying Quicktime engine.

Part IV. Converting Recorded TV Content
Another type of content that many iPad users will want to convert is content recorded from broadcast television sources, such as over-the-air, cable, and satellite programming. This content can come from digital video recording software installed directly onto a Mac, or from an external DVR such as a Tivo, and EyeTV allows for the handling of either.

EyeTV is probably the most popular solution for recording TV content on a Mac. Selecting a show from the online TV guide will have the advantage of ensuring that the particulars of a given recording for you, and when scheduling a recording, you can also tell EyeTV to export to an iPad format immediately after it finishes the recording. The converted video will also be automatically imported into iTunes with the correct name, description and show tags filled in from the TV guide information, ready to be synced to your iPad device.

Michael Joseph Jackson, often referred to as The King of Pop, is the biggest-selling solo artist of all time, with over 750,000,000 sales. Jackson is an inductee of the Songwriters Hall of Fame, and double inductee to the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ame. His awards include 8 Guinness World Records, 13 Grammy Awards, and 26 Billboard Awards.
